    1. Under normal circumstances, win7 will not occupy too much memory after starting, it should be the automatic start of other programs that are installed, resulting in more processes, and the number of normal processes is about 75.

    2. It is recommended that you enter "resource" in the "Start" menu - "Search box" to enter the performance monitor to see which process occupies the larger process. Also try a clean start:

    Step 1: Launch the System Configuration Utility.

    1. Log in to the computer with an account with administrator privileges.

    If you're prompted to enter your administrator password or confirm it, type your password or click Continue.

    Step 2: Configure the "Selective Startup" option.

    1. On the General tab, click Selective Startup.

    2. Under "Selective Startup", click to clear the "Load Startup Items" checkbox.

    3. Click the Services tab, click to select the Hide all Microsoft services check box, and then click Disable all.

    4. Click the "Enable" tab card, then click "Disable All" and confirm.

    5. Then click "Restart".

    Step 3: Sign in to Windows

    1. If prompted, sign in to Windows.

    2. When you receive the following greeting message, click to select the "Do not display this information or start the system configuration utility when Windows starts" check box, and then click "OK".

    After your computer boots up, open your mind to test and see if the problem persists.
